329#=======================================================================
330# Definition of Smooth modulo function
331# usage :
332# IGCM_SmoothModulo StringModulo value
333#
334# StringModulo : A string of min max and modulo like definition of Scilab vectors.
335# [min]:[modulo:][max]
336# where :
337# [] value are optionnals;
338# empty min equal 1
339# empty max equal infinity
340# modulo not given or empty equal 1
341# empty string or just ':' equal always.
342#
343# value : the value to test with the definition
344#
345# return : true(1)/false(0)
346function IGCM_SmoothModulo
347{
348  IGCM_debug_PushStack "IGCM_SmoothModulo"
349  typeset defVector ModValue
350
351  eval set +A defVector -- $( echo "${1}" | \
352    gawk -F ':' '{print ($1 == "" ? 1 : $1) " " (NF==3 ? ($2 == "" ? 1 : $2) : 1) " " (NF==3 ? ($3 == "" ? -1 : $3) : ($2 == "" ? -1 : $2))}' )
353
354  # Save Smooth Min and Max. Needed to call IGCM_sys_Get when appropriate
355  arr[1]=${defVector[0]}
356  arr[2]=${defVector[2]}
357
358  # Test limits :
359  # ${defVector[0]} <= ${2} <= ${defVector[2]}
360  #          or ${defVector[2]} == -1
361  if ( [ ${2} -ge ${defVector[0]} ] && ( [ ${2} -le ${defVector[2]} ] || [ ${defVector[2]} -lt 0 ] ) ) ; then
362    # Test modulo
363    ModValue=$( expr \( ${2} - ${defVector[0]} \) % ${defVector[1]} )
364    if [ ${ModValue} -eq 0 ] ;  then
365      arr[3]=true
366      echo ${arr[@]}
367      IGCM_debug_PopStack "IGCM_SmoothModulo"
368      return 1
369    else
370      arr[3]=false
371      echo ${arr[@]}
372      IGCM_debug_PopStack "IGCM_SmoothModulo"
373      return 0
374    fi
375  else
376    arr[3]=false
377    echo ${arr[@]}
378    IGCM_debug_PopStack "IGCM_SmoothModulo"
379    return 0
380  fi
381}
